Catalogue entry

FWN 118
La Baie de Marseille, avec vue sur le village Saint-Henri près de l'Estaque
1877–79
Alternate titles: L'Estaque; La Baie de Marseille vue du village de Saint-Henri; Landschaft; Saint-Henri, à l'Estaque
Rewald (281): 1877–79; Venturi revised: 1883–85; Venturi (398): 1882–85; Vollard: 1883; Cooper: between May 1883 and January 1884; Ratcliffe: after 1882
Oil on canvas
26 3/16 x 32 11/16 in. (66.5 x 83 cm)

Keywords

Provenance
Ambroise Vollard, Paris
Jos. Hessel, Paris
Paul Rosenberg, Paris and New York
Mr. and Mrs. Carroll S. Tyson, Jr., Philadelphia;
Mr. and Mrs. Charles R. Tyson Philadelphia;
Sotheby's, New York, May 10, 1988, no. 20, ill.
Urban Gallery, Tokyo
Yoshino Gypsum Co., Tokyo (on loan to the Yamagata Museum of Art)
